Features of the Mombo™ Nursing Pillow

  • The Mombo™ has a unique contour shape for comfort.
  • It has a two-sided design called Firm2Soft™, with each side offering a different experience.  The firm side gives essential support for mommy and her nursing baby. The soft side is extra cozy—an inviting place for lounging or tummy time.
  • It is the only nursing pillow with a vibration feature, to give baby the ultimate soothing experience while lounging.  My kids loved their vibrating bouncers so I am very excited to try out this feature!
  • Available at Babies R Us
  • There are various pillow styles and covers that are available, so there is something for everyone’s taste.
